Fitness Concern ‘dangerous’ performance enhancers are being sold online Published 3 hours ago on May 11, 2026 By News24x7 Share Tweet UK Anti-Doping have published research into SARMs being sold on social media platforms. The survey found a third of people aged 16-25 see ads for SARMs every week.
